A bill to terminate operation of the Extremely Low Frequency Communication System of the Navy.
Introduced: January 19, 1999

Plain-English summary
Directs the Secretary of the Navy to terminate operation of the Extremely Low Frequency Communication System while maintaining the infrastructure necessary for its resumption.
